Kohima: The India Meteorological Department expects a wet week ahead. Heavy to very heavy rainfall, measuring between 7 and 20 centimeters, will soak the Northeast region and Sub-Himalayan West Bengal and Sikkim starting June 24, 2026.
Forecasters track widespread rain across Arunachal Pradesh, Assam, Meghalaya, Nagaland, Manipur, Mizoram, and Tripura through June 29. Isolated thunderstorms and lightning will hit these same areas between June 24 and June 27. The weather will turn dangerous.
Specific alerts highlight isolated heavy rainfall for Arunachal Pradesh from June 26 to 29. Assam and Meghalaya face downpours on June 24 and 25, returning on June 28 and 29. The agency noted that "isolated very heavy rainfall also likely over Assam & Meghalaya during June 26 & 27." Nagaland, Manipur, Mizoram, and Tripura can expect heavy precipitation during that same two day window.
